The present invention relates to a method for reconstructing a video signal through a low complexity discrete sine transform7 (DST7) design, the method comprising the steps of: acquiring a transform index of a current block from the video signal, wherein the transform index corresponds to one among a plurality of transform combinations including a combination of DST7 and/or discrete cosine transform8 (DST8); deriving a transform combination corresponding to the transform index, wherein the transform combination includes a horizontal transform and a vertical transform, and the horizontal transform and the vertical transform correspond to one of DST7 and DST8; performing an inverse transform in the vertical or horizontal direction on the current block by using DST7 or DST8; and reconstructing the video signal by using the inversely transformed current block, wherein a 33-point discrete Fourier transform (DFT) is applied to DST7 when DST7 is 16x16, and a 65-point DFT is applied to DST7 when DST7 is 32x32.
